Dream Chasers Sickle Cell Foundation Hosts Annual Awareness Walk

Sickle cell disease, recognized as the most common inherited blood disorder in the United States, affects around 100,000 Americans and approximately 7.74 million individuals globally. In response to this pressing health concern, the Dream Chasers Sickle Cell Foundation is hosting its third annual Community Sickle Cell Awareness Walk in Beaufort, South Carolina, aimed at raising awareness and funds for research.
The event is scheduled for September 13, 2023, from 10 AM to 4 PM at the Cross Creek Shopping Center, located at 330 Robert Smalls Parkway. Participants can register for a fee of $10, which will directly support the foundation’s mission to educate the community about sickle cell disease and its impact on affected individuals and their families.
Co-founders of the foundation, Celeste Walls and Darrius Brockington, discussed their commitment to this cause in an interview with WSAV’s Kim Gusby. They emphasized the importance of community involvement in supporting sickle cell warriors and their families. The foundation strives not only to raise funds for research but also to foster a supportive network for those affected by the disease.
The Community Sickle Cell Awareness Walk serves as a vital platform for educating attendees about sickle cell disease, its symptoms, and the ongoing need for research toward a cure. As the foundation continues its efforts, support from the community will play a pivotal role in advancing awareness and funding critical research initiatives.
